While South Bank station might not boast the plethora of amenities found in larger stations, it offers the basics in a compact setting. There is no ticket office or ticket machine available, so travelers should purchase tickets online prior to arriving. Although ticket collection isn't offered, the absence of ticket barriers ensures that your journey can proceed with minimal disruption.
Accessibility at the station is somewhat limited, classified as a Category B station. There's step-free access to platform 1 (heading towards Middlesbrough) from Normanby Road, which is helpful for travelers using wheelchairs. Unfortunately, access to platform 2 (heading towards Saltburn) requires navigating a footbridge. However, don't let accessibility concerns deter you; boarding ramps are available on all trains, and assistance can be arranged.
Although South Bank station lacks direct bus services, it serves as a convenient pick-up point for rail replacement services during disruptions. For door-to-door convenience, you can explore taxi options through local services. While bus links might be limited, travelers can call Busline at 0871 200 2233 for further details on available services in the area.

The station offers a range of fac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. There is a ticket office open from 5:55 AM to 11:50 PM on weekdays and a bit shorter on Sundays, from 9:45 AM to 5:30 PM.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and they are equipped for online ticket collection as well. It's worth noting that accessible ticket machines are in place and an induction loop is available for hearing aid users.
Accessibility is a key consideration, though West Allerton is a Category C station. This means that it comes with a 23cm step out of the ticket office, followed by two flights of stairs down to the platforms. Assistance is available with advance booking, helping to ensure that all passengers can travel confidently.
Safety is bolstered by CCTV surveillance while customer help points are strategically placed. Notably, there are no toilets, waiting rooms, or refreshment facilities on the premises. Yet, the station offers free WiFi for those who might want to while away their time surfing the web, or planning the next leg of their journey. Bicycle storage solutions are non-existent, but cycle hire information can be found, although it is not specifically available at the station.
Thanks to its transport links, West Allerton is not just a train station but a gateway to a broader network. It is well-integrated with local bus services, with a bus stop located 200 yards away from the station. The Rail Replacement Services pick up and drop off on Booker Avenue, making it convenient whether you're heading to Liverpool or Warrington. Although the station does not have its own taxi rank, taxi services can be availed through various online platforms.
